Find the slope, or rate of change, from the following table

Answer:

m = 2/3

Step-by-step explanation:

Pick two points and use the slope formula to find the slope/rate of change. I'll use (3, 2) and (6, 4).

Slope formula: [tex]m=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}[/tex]

[tex]m=\frac{4-2}{6-3}\\\\m=\frac{2}{3}[/tex]

Therefore, the slope of the table is 2/3.
